Output f3331211ee2380c32ced881a6800d2cfd66be4be5c05ff881e26df16dcb209a5:14

value
39859
script pubkey
OP_0 OP_PUSHBYTES_20 5c9bed175e2d7c0883e9a0ff28855294a500c264
address
bc1qtjd76967947q3qlf5rlj3p2jjjjspsnyhwray8
transaction
f3331211ee2380c32ced881a6800d2cfd66be4be5c05ff881e26df16dcb209a5
confirmations
94025
spent
true